In 2017, it became the seat with the highest majority for any British Member of Parliament since the advent of universal suffrage, with Howarth winning a majority of 42,214 votes for Labour, surpassing the 36,230-vote majority held by then-Conservative Prime Minister John Major in his Huntingdon constituency in 1992. Election turnout for the Knowsley constituency in 2015 was 64.10%, The current Knowsley constituency was only created in 2010, and includes Huyton, Kirkby, Knowsley Village, Stockbridge Village and the western part of Prescot. flicks, Knowsley South, Knowsley in Merseyside is the second highest ranking constituency for needing support, with low income, fuel poverty and an exceptionally high need for family food support in 96% of its local areas. The Knowsley constituency comprises Huyton, Kirkby, Knowsley Village, Stockbridge Village and the western part of Prescot. Covering most of the borough of Knowsley - one of the country's most deprived areas - the seat and its previous incarnations have been represented by Labour MPs since 1950, when future prime minister Harold Wilson was first elected for the constituency then known as Huyton..
